      My first idea was to have velero use a different storage class. Something like

      apiVersion: storage.k8s.io/v1
      kind: StorageClass
      metadata:
        name: linstor-ephemeral-retain
      parameters:
        linstor.csi.linbit.com/allowRemoteVolumeAccess: "true"
        linstor.csi.linbit.com/disklessOnRemaining: "true"
        linstor.csi.linbit.com/disklessStoragePool: DfltDisklessStorPool
        linstor.csi.linbit.com/placementCount: "3"
      provisioner: linstor.csi.linbit.com
      **reclaimPolicy: Retain**
      volumeBindingMode: WaitForFirstConsumer
      

      Then have a cronjob collected the Released pvcs every hour. The problem is that can not work, as velero uses the storage class of the backed up pvc. So I would have to change every linstor storage class to Retain, and would effectively disable the automatic garbage collection for the cluster. Which might be fine, but would love to avoid it.

      My second idea is to eliminate the need for the resizing (another work around to hopefully get away from this race condition/bug)
      I am also not seeing any way to modify the storageclass to round up or pad the pv. This would be to attempt to eliminate the need for drbd_bm_resize.
      Currently looking into Kyverno Mutating Webhook to dynamically pad these volumes on the fly to see if that would help me out at all.
      All pvs are already whole numbers of Gi.
      Velero calculates the size of the temporary clone pvc based on the exact byte-count of the used/allocated snapshot metadata, not the #Gi specification of the original pvc.
      Just confirmed with a test

          Logs from xen04 look like they are the same too. Which makes sense.

          20:01:53.805: The Linstor DeviceManager on xen04 triggered an asynchronous alignment for a newly created volume (pvc-fac0a18b-2c23-4fe8-b005-b4f492cec92f), padding it from 26220040 KiB to 26222592 KiB.
          
          20:01:54.034: Simultaneously, an orchestrator (like Velero) began tearing the volume down, shifting the DRBD state to conn( Connected -> TearDown ) and pdsk( Diskless -> DUnknown ).
          
          20:01:58.484: The DRBD worker thread evaluated the shrinking bitmap while the alignment was trying to alter it. This caused the general protection fault: 0000 [#1] SMP NOPTI at instruction RIP: e030:drbd_bm_count_bits+0x223/0x300 [drbd], crashing the kernel.

            That timeline is the clearest version of this yet. xen04 going down the same way as xen05 makes the race look real to me rather than coincidental, unless I am reading the ordering wrong.
            The fault lands inside drbd_bm_count_bits, so in the DRBD module itself, which makes me think this is an upstream LINBIT question as much as an XCP-ng one. I do not know enough about how that module gets packaged here to say who owns the fix though. Might be worth another mention to @Team-Storage so someone can open your bundles with your post #10 next to them.
            On the padding idea I am out of my depth: no idea whether LINSTOR can be told to pre-round a volume at creation, but asking LINBIT directly seems worth a try since it would sidestep drbd_bm_resize entirely. 🤷

                  On the version question, 8.3 ships DRBD 9.2.18 right now (that's what kmod-drbd.spec says on the 8.3 branch), so you'd be asking for a single point bump rather than a big jump.
                  That probably helps you. Of your two links though, I think the netlink crash fix is a 9.2.17 entry, which would mean it's already in what you're running. 🤷
                  The 9.2.19 line that looks closest to your crash to me is the connection-teardown races one rather than the AB-BA deadlock, since a deadlock would hang rather than throw a GPF, but you've read these traces far more closely than I have so correct me if that's backwards.
                  I can't request a build myself, that's a @Team-Storage call rather than mine, though your post #13 timeline next to those changelog lines is a stronger case than most version-bump requests turn up with.
